Does anyone have any input on originating caller ID not passing through to a forwarded call to a mobile phone? The call hits a hunt group that forwards to an ACD path with an interflow endpoint that is forwarded to a mobile phone. I am not seeing the originating caller ID, is this by design or might I have missed something? The path and the interflow endpoint are on two different controllers over direct IP trunks.

Assuming you have PRIs supporting the outbound calls, go into the ISDN Protocol form and check the "Replace External CLID" setting(s), depending on where the call goes out.

By "originating caller ID" are you referring to the ID of an external caller into your system that is then forwarded? If so, effectively you are making an external call to the mobile and trying to present a number that you don't have. Not all trunk providers support this.
